What is Dry Needling and How Does It Work?

Dry needling involves inserting thin, solid needles into trigger points—those irritable, tight bands of muscle that can cause pain and restricted movement. One theory suggests that these trigger points develop from chronic muscle shortening and reduced blood flow, leading to inflammation and nerve sensitization. When compressed, these points cause pain responses.
- Myofascial Trigger Points (MTP): These are areas of hyperirritability in a taut band of muscle that can cause pain, tenderness, and altered motor function.
- Theories of MTP Development: One theory suggests that chronic shortening of muscle fibers, along with autonomic changes, leads to localized ischemia. This results in the release of inflammatory substances that sensitize the nervous system.
- Local Twitch Response (LTR): Many practitioners aim to elicit a local twitch response during dry needling, which is a visible contraction of the muscle. While some studies suggest this improves pain reduction, the evidence is still debated.
Making Informed Decisions About Dry Needling
Dry needling is a rising method that, when accompanied by physiotherapy, may provide short-term pain relief. However, more research is needed to fully understand its long-term benefits. It is important to discuss with your healthcare provider whether dry needling aligns with your health needs.
